Understanding the Basics of Serving Sizes
Before diving into the calculations, it’s crucial to understand what a “serving size” actually represents. It’s the recommended amount of a food item that you should consume in one sitting, as defined by manufacturers and nutrition guidelines. Serving sizes are standardized to allow for easier comparison of nutritional information across different products.
However, it’s important to distinguish between a “serving size” and a “portion size.” A serving size is a standard measurement, while a portion size is the amount of food you choose to eat. You might choose to eat more or less than the recommended serving size depending on your individual needs and preferences.
Serving sizes are usually provided in common measurements like cups, ounces, grams, or pieces. Always check the nutrition label for the serving size information, typically listed near the top of the label.

Methods for Calculating Food Per Serving
There are several methods for calculating food per serving, each with its own advantages and disadvantages. The best method will depend on the type of recipe and the level of accuracy you need.
The Division Method
This is the simplest method and works well for recipes where the ingredients are easily divisible. Here’s how it works:
- Determine the recipe yield (total amount of food produced).
- Decide on the desired number of servings.
- Divide the recipe yield by the number of servings.
For example, if a pot of soup yields 8 cups and you want to serve 4 people, each serving would be 2 cups (8 cups / 4 servings = 2 cups per serving).
The Weight Method
This method is more accurate than the division method, especially for recipes with variable ingredients or significant waste.
- Weigh all the ingredients before cooking.
- Cook the recipe.
- Weigh the finished dish.
- Determine the desired number of servings.
- Divide the total weight of the finished dish by the number of servings.
For instance, if a baked casserole weighs 1200 grams after cooking, and you want to serve 6 people, each serving would weigh 200 grams (1200 grams / 6 servings = 200 grams per serving).
Using Nutrition Information Labels
Nutrition labels provide information on serving sizes and nutrient content. Follow these steps:
- Identify the serving size listed on the nutrition label.
- Note the nutrient content per serving (calories, protein, fat, carbohydrates, etc.).
- Adjust the amount you eat based on your individual needs.
If you consume twice the serving size, you’ll consume twice the calories and nutrients. This is a straightforward way to manage your intake of specific nutrients.
The Recipe Scaling Method
If you want to adjust the recipe to increase or decrease the yield, you will need to scale the recipe.
- Determine the desired yield and compare it to the original recipe yield.
- Calculate the scaling factor by dividing the desired yield by the original yield.
- Multiply each ingredient amount by the scaling factor.
For instance, if the original recipe yields 4 servings and you want 8, the scaling factor is 2. Double all ingredient amounts for the larger batch.

Example Scenarios: Calculating Food Per Serving
Let’s look at a few examples to illustrate how to calculate food per serving in different scenarios.
Scenario 1: Calculating Servings for a Batch of Cookies
You bake a batch of 24 cookies. You want to know how many cookies constitute one serving.
- Recipe yield: 24 cookies
- Desired number of servings: Let’s say you want each serving to be 2 cookies.
- Calculation: 24 cookies / 12 servings = 2 cookies per serving.
Therefore, a serving size is 2 cookies, and the batch will yield 12 servings.
Scenario 2: Calculating Servings for a Pot of Chili
You make a pot of chili that weighs 1500 grams after cooking. You want to serve 5 people.
- Recipe yield (weight): 1500 grams
- Desired number of servings: 5
- Calculation: 1500 grams / 5 servings = 300 grams per serving.
Each person should receive 300 grams of chili.
Scenario 3: Using Nutrition Labels for Cereal
You’re eating cereal for breakfast. The nutrition label says one serving is 3/4 cup (30 grams) and contains 120 calories. You eat 1 1/2 cups of cereal.
- Serving size on the label: 3/4 cup (30 grams)
- Your portion size: 1 1/2 cups (60 grams, which is double the serving size)
- Calculation: Since you consumed double the serving size, you consumed 240 calories (120 calories x 2).
You’ve consumed 240 calories from the cereal.

Why is it important to consider cooked versus uncooked weights?
Cooked versus uncooked weights significantly impact nutritional calculations, especially for ingredients like pasta, rice, and meats. These foods can absorb or release water during cooking, leading to substantial changes in their weight and nutrient density. Using the uncooked weight for cooked foods will overestimate the per-serving nutrient content, while using the cooked weight for uncooked foods will underestimate it.
Therefore, it is crucial to use the appropriate weight (cooked or uncooked) that corresponds to the ingredient’s state when it’s actually measured and incorporated into the recipe. For example, if you weigh the rice after it’s been cooked and then use this weight in your calculation, you’ll have a more accurate representation of the nutrients present in that portion of cooked rice.
How do you account for ingredient loss during cooking (e.g., rendered fat)?
To accurately account for ingredient loss, especially rendered fat from meats, you must carefully measure the total weight of the food after cooking and subtract the weight of the separated rendered fat. Collect the rendered fat, let it cool, and then weigh it. This weight is then subtracted from the total cooked weight of the food before calculating per-serving values.
Ignoring rendered fat will lead to overestimation of the fat content per serving. By specifically accounting for this loss, you gain a more precise understanding of the actual nutrient composition of the edible portion. This is especially important for recipes where a significant amount of fat is rendered during cooking, as it can substantially alter the final nutrient profile.
What’s the best method for calculating servings when dealing with leftover ingredients?
The best method involves calculating the total weight of the cooked dish, subtracting the weight of any leftovers removed, and then dividing the remaining weight by the intended number of servings. First, weigh the entire finished dish. Then, weigh any leftovers removed before portioning. Subtract the leftover weight from the total cooked weight to get the weight of the portioned food.
Finally, divide this remaining weight by the desired number of servings. This gives you the weight per serving, which you can then use with nutrient data to determine the nutritional content of each serving. This method ensures accuracy by accounting for any variations in serving sizes or ingredient loss during preparation.

What are some common mistakes people make when calculating food per serving?
One common mistake is estimating ingredients instead of precisely measuring them. Eyeballing or using approximate measurements leads to inaccuracies in the total nutrient composition and, consequently, in the per-serving values. Another frequent error is neglecting to account for changes in weight due to cooking, such as water absorption or fat rendering.
Another mistake is inconsistent portion sizes when serving. Even if the recipe is calculated accurately, variations in serving sizes will result in individuals consuming different amounts of nutrients than intended. It’s important to use consistent serving utensils or containers to ensure that each portion is as close to the calculated serving size as possible.
How do you factor in variable ingredients like different brands of the same item?
When using variable ingredients, always refer to the nutrition facts label of the specific brand you are using. Different brands of the same item (e.g., tomato sauce, cereal) can have significantly different nutritional profiles due to variations in ingredients, processing methods, and added nutrients. Relying on generic nutritional data can lead to inaccuracies.
If the brand you use is unavailable in your chosen nutrition database, you may need to manually adjust the calculations using the nutrition facts label. Pay particular attention to serving size, calories, fat, carbohydrates, protein, and sodium. This ensures that your calculations accurately reflect the nutritional content of the specific ingredients in your recipe.
